sparc64: Trim page tables for 8M hugepages

For PMD aligned (8M) hugepages, we currently allocate
all four page table levels which is wasteful. We now
allocate till PMD level only which saves memory usage
from page tables.

Also, when freeing page table for 8M hugepage backed region,
make sure we don't try to access non-existent PTE level.
